The Department of Recreation and Leisure Studies, in collaboration with Alpine Ascents International, is offering a 13-day mountaineering course this summer, led by professional leaders in the Cascade Mountains of Washington State.

RLS-27800 Glacier Mountaineering
2 credits, NLA, Pass/Fail

Instruction will include all aspects of snow, ice, and alpine rock climbing with ascents of technical alpine rock peaks. This course is designed for beginning and intermediate climbers who are in good condition.
